
stc89c51
STC89C51单片机学习板是一款基于8位单片机处理晶片STC89C51RC的系统。
基本介绍
- 中文名:stc89c51
- 工作电压:3.4V-5.5V
- 工作频率範围:0-35 MHz
- 计数器:2个16位
- 引脚:40
原理
STC89C51RC是採用8051核的ISP(In System Programming)在系统可程式晶片,最高工作时钟频率为80MHz,片内含4K Bytes的可反覆擦写1000次的Flash唯读程式存储器,器件兼容标準MCS-51指令系统及80C51引脚结构,晶片内集成了通用8位中央处理器和ISP Flash存储单元,具有在系统可程式(ISP)特性,配合PC端的控制程式即可将用户的程式代码下载进单片机内部,省去了购买通用编程器,而且速度更快。STC89C51RC系列单片机是单时钟/机器周期(1T)的兼容8051 核心单片机,是高速/ 低功耗的新一代8051 单片机,全新的流水线/精简指令集结构,内部集成MAX810 专用复位电路。
特点
(1)增强型1T 流水线/精简指令集结构8051 CPU
(2)(5V单片机)/ 2.0V-3.8V (3V 单片机
(3)时钟频率0~35MHz,相当于普通8051 的0~420MHz.实际工作频率可达48MHz.
(4)用户应用程式空间12K / 10K / 8K / 6K / 4K / 2K位元组
(5)片上集成512 位元组RAM
(6)通用I/O 口(27/23个),复位后为:準双向口/ 弱上拉(普通8051 传统I/O 口)
可设定成四种模式:準双向口/ 弱上拉,推挽/ 强上拉,仅为输入/高阻,开漏
每个I/O 口驱动能力均可达到20mA,但整个晶片最大不得超过55mA
(7)ISP(在系统可程式)/IAP(在套用可程式),无需专用编程器
可通过串口(P3.0/P3.1)直接下载用户程式,数秒即可完成一片
(8)EEPROM 功能
(9)看门狗
(10)内部集成MAX810 专用复位电路(外部晶体20M 以下时,可省外部复位电路)
(11)时钟源:外部高精度晶体/ 时钟,内部R/C 振荡器。用户在下载用户程式时,可选择是使用内部R/C 振荡器还是外部晶体/ 时钟。常温下内部R/C 振荡器频率为:5.2MHz ~6.8MHz。精度要求不高时,可选择使用内部时钟,因为有温漂,请选4MHz ~8MHz
(12)有2个16 位定时器/ 计数器
(13)外部中断2 路,下降沿中断或低电平触发中断,Power Down 模式可由外部中断低电平触发中断方式唤醒
(14)PWM( 4 路)/ P C A(可程式计数器阵列),也可用来再实现4个定时器或4个外部中断(上升沿中断/ 下降沿中断均可支持)
(15)STC89Cc516AD具有ADC功能。10 位精度ADC,共8 路
(16)通用异步串列口(UART)
(17)SPI同步通信口,主模式/ 从模式
(18)工作温度範围:0 -75℃/ -40 -+85℃
(19)封装:PDIP-28,SOP-28,PDIP-20,SOP-20,PLCC-32,TSSOP-20(超小封装,定货)